Sniper’s roost

San Diego county sheriff Bill Gore has put out word that he’s in the market for 25 brand-new Smith & Wesson M&P15 AR .223 rifles, each to be equipped with an EOtech 512A65 holographic weapon sight. The MP in the rifle’s name stands for “Military & Police,” and the long gun is loaded with bells and whistles for the expert sniper, according to friendly fans. The gas-operated, semiautomatic carbine comes battle-ready out of the box in a variety of configurations for sniping at bad guys and other forms of urban combat, according to the gun’s maker. A reviewer for Guns & Ammo magazine commended the weapon’s long range: ”I just love a good quarter-mile coyote gun. Who would have thought I’d find one in an AR-15 type wearing a Smith & Wesson label?”
